Ukraine has to reduce purchases of the Russian gas under a price pressure and intend to buy 18 billion cubic meters in 2013, President Viktor Yanukovych said during a meeting with chairman of the Interfax international press centre Mykhaylo Komisar and executive director of news agency Interfax-Ukraine Oleksandr Martynenko.

Yanukovych noted that the partnership of Ukraine and Russia was different in the gas issue in different times, but it is a difficult period now, and both sides suffer damages.

The head of state added that if Ukraine has more price pressure, then Kyiv will be more interested in different sources of gas supply.

"If not, we will continue to reduce a volume of purchases and find more cost-effective alternative sources of gas supply," Yanukovych stressed.
